How To Fix E4061 - Program & will be copied to & asynchronously


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: E4 - Program maintenance functions within development system

  • Message number: 061

  • Message text: Program & will be copied to & asynchronously

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message E4061 - Program & will be copied to & asynchronously ?

    The SAP error message E4061 typically indicates an issue related to the asynchronous processing of a program or a task in the SAP system. This error can occur in various contexts, such as during the execution of background jobs, data transfers, or when using certain SAP transactions that involve asynchronous processing.

    Cause:

    1. Program Not Found: The specified program may not exist in the system or may not be properly activated.
    2. Authorization Issues: The user executing the program may not have the necessary authorizations to run the program or access the required data.
    3. Configuration Issues: There may be configuration problems in the system that prevent the program from being executed asynchronously.
    4. System Performance: High system load or performance issues may lead to problems in processing asynchronous tasks.
    5. Transport Issues: If the program is being transported from one system to another, there may be issues with the transport itself.

    Solution:

    1. Check Program Existence: Verify that the program mentioned in the error message exists in the system and is activated. You can do this by using transaction SE38 or SE80.
    2. Review Authorizations: Ensure that the user has the necessary authorizations to execute the program. You can check this using transaction SU53 or by reviewing the user's roles and authorizations.
    3. Check Configuration: Review the configuration settings related to the program or the asynchronous processing. This may involve checking settings in transaction SM37 (for job monitoring) or other relevant configuration transactions.
    4. Monitor System Performance: Use transaction ST22 (dump analysis) and SM21 (system log) to check for any performance issues or dumps that may be affecting the execution of asynchronous tasks.
    5. Transport Check: If the program was recently transported, ensure that the transport was successful and that all necessary objects were included in the transport request.
    6. Debugging: If the issue persists, consider debugging the program to identify any specific points of failure.
